Fabian Marez Tossed a Pair of Touchdown Passes in South Hills’ 21-17 Week One Victory at Ayala

Football:

South Hills traveled to Chino Hills on Friday night to battle an Ayala program that hasn’t won a football game since August 31st of 2024.

And the Huskies entered Friday’s showdown at 0-1 after an eight-point loss at El Rancho in their week zero contest.

After a scoreless first quarter, SHHS scored one TD apiece in the second, third and fourth quarters to edge Ayala, 21-17.

The Bulldogs have now lost their last 20 games.

South Hills had a pretty balanced attack with 182 yards through the air and another 161 on the ground.

Fabian Marez completed 16-of-29 for 182 yards.

He tossed a pair of TD passes and no picks.

Marez also gained 25 yards on three carries.

Justin Jimenez led the Huskies ground game with 68 yards on 12 carries.

Jorge Aldaco carried the ball eight times for 52 yards, including one TD run.

Jayden Lang carried the ball three times for 16 yards.

Maxal Rodriguez reeled in seven passes for a game-high 93 receiving yards and one TD catch.

Jacob Gallardo had eight catches for 84 yards and one TD.

James Perez and Landon Jaramillo led the Huskies defense with eight tackles apiece.

Daniel Calderon had six tackles, while Reilly Whitter and Jacob Gallardo finished with five tackles apiece.

Up next: The Huskies travel to Diamond Ranch next Friday at 7.

The Panthers (0-2) are enduring a brutal start to the 2026 season.

They’ve dropped consecutive games to Los Altos and Bonita by a combined margin of 97-0.

Box Score:
SH: 0-7-7-7-(21)
A: 0-10-7-0-(17)

Records: South Hills (1-1); Ayala (0-2)
